WebJan 20, 2024 · Passion fruit has a significantly exclusive sourness and is citrusy, unlike any other tropical fruit. Depending on various kinds of passion fruits, the sugar level in each kind will vary, but overall it takes up 30-40% of the fruit. The passion fruit flavor profile somehow resembles the flavor of mango and gooseberry mixed together.
WebMar 27, 2024 · noun. : the edible fruit of a passionflower. especially : the small roundish purple or yellow fruit of a Brazilian passionflower (Passiflora edulis) grown commercially in warmer parts of the U.S. compare granadilla. WebAug 7, 2024 · The passion fruit is so called because it is one of the many species of passion flower, the English translation of the Latin genus name, Passiflora, and may be spelled “passion fruit”, “passionfruit”, or “passion-fruit”. WebApr 14, 2011 · A Passion Fruit is an egg-shaped tropical fruit with wrinkled purple-brown skin enclosing flesh-covered seeds. The seeds and flesh are edible and taste sweet and aromatic.
WebPassion fruit is a form of berry that grows on the passion fruit plant, also called the passionfruit vine. Passion fruit is easy to grow.
